GU34 3QG is a residential postcode in East Tisted, Hampshire. It was first introduced in January 1995.
The most common council tax bands are G and F.
Residential buildings are primarily detached. Domestic properties are primarily houses.
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£216,233 to £4,167,761 with an average of £833,148.
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1991 and 1995.
None of the residential properties sold since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.
Domestic properties are predominantly owner occupied.
The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ating is D.
In the 2011 census, there were 20 people resident in GU34 3QG, of which 8 were male and 12 were female. This includes overnight visitors as well as permanent residents.
GU34 3QG is in the Southampton trav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Hampshire Primary Care Trust.
GU34 3QG is approximately 149m (489ft) above sea level.
